Job Description
Position: Business Rules / Decision Engine Developer
Industry: Financial Services
Type: 6-month Contract to Hire
Location: Wilmington, DE (3x Hybrid)
Day to day:
- Work within the risk and rules development team on the business side as they move through the execution tasks
- The individual selected would be exposed to two major initiatives
- Coding within the rules engine:
- Drools experience - open-source decision engine that would be a nice to have or a plus
- The other side is the existing strategy management of the decision engine - open to any kind of decision engine not just focused on one
- Ramp up on the current decision engine architecture and business workflows
- Support the incremental development lifecycle by working with technology, credit risk and product teams
- Test and deploy in support of transitioning from an on prem decision engine to a modernized cloud native implementation
- Analyze and identify areas for optimization as the platform transitions to the target state.
Must haves:
- Top three skills: Decision engine / Python / Java / AWS cloud
- Ability to communicate effectively with technical and non-technical stakeholders.
- 10+ years of hands-on work related to:
- Experience and involvement with strategy based decisioning platforms / decision engines/rule-based systems
- Programming experience (Java) and a strong fundamental understanding of data structures
- Proven experience in modernizing enterprise systems to cloud native architectures
- Strong knowledge of AWS Cloud, containerization (e.g., Kubernetes, Docker), and programming in Java and JSON to support design and implementation tasks
Plusses:
- Drools experience
- Prior optimization engine experience within the decision space
- Within financial services (Credit & Lending)
Salary and Compensation:
The hourly rate for this position is between $80 - $85 per hour. Factors which may affect pay within this range may include geography/market, skills, education, experience, and other qualifications of the successful candidate.
Benefits:
The Company offers the following benefits for this position, subject to applicable eligibility requirements: medical insurance, dental insurance, vision insurance, 401(k) retirement plan, life insurance, long-term disability insurance, short-term disability insurance, paid parking/public transportation, (paid time, paid sick and safe time, hours of paid vacation time, weeks of paid parental leave, paid holidays annually - AS Applicable).
